Alpharetta, GA Award-winning architecture, design, and strategy firm NELSON Worldwide welcomes Aaron Nacey as Senior Project Manager, CCJ&E. In his new role, Aaron will cross-collaborate with the client, design and contracting teams to successfully navigate project scopes, schedules, and budgets from ideation to implementation. This comes as exciting news for the Civic, Community, Justice & Education (CCJ&E) practice on the heels of welcoming David Crotty as Regional Practice Leader this past December.

With more than 25 years of experience in architecture, engineering, construction and business, Aaron has a long history of working with local and state governments on project types that span various focus areas, including: university, parks, fire and police, maintenance, church, non-profit, theater, convention, sporting, and government office facilities. Previous clients of his include the Commonwealth of Kentucky, University of Southern Indiana, Murray State University, Kentucky National Guard, Unilever, and Alorica. Along with his breadth of project type experiences, Aaron will be adding depth to NELSON in the areas of adaptive reuse, roofing methodologies, and construction administration.

Aaron’s diverse portfolio of projects and methodologies has been featured and awarded by various organizations including AIA Indiana, AIA Kentucky, American School & University, Masonry Magazine, Metal Construction News, National Ready Mixed Concrete Association and World Architects. 

Aaron earned his Bachelor of Science in Civil Engineering from Western Kentucky University. Prior to joining NELSON, Aaron co-founded and operated a successful Kentucky-based architecture firm. About NELSON Worldwide

NELSON Worldwide is an award-winning firm, boldly transforming all dimensions of the human experience through architecture, interior design, graphic design, and brand strategy. With more than 700 teammates across 20 offices, the firm’s collective network provides strategic and creative solutions that positively impact where people work, serve, play, and thrive. The team combines industry knowledge, service expertise, and geographic reach to deliver projects across the country and around the world.
